High-performance electric vehicles have become a battleground. Volvo has inherited Polestar and can challenge Tesla and BMW.

Polestar (North Star), acquired two years ago, was originally a high-performance department. It wants to compete with Mercedes-Benz AMG, BMW M and Audi RS series, but now Volvo's ambitions are not limited to this, it has to challenge higher goals. Directly compete with the Tesla and BMW i brands in the future.

Polestar's LOGO does have the futuristic look of Tesla.

Polestar is a racing brand from Sweden. It has won numerous awards in international competitions and later became the official designated partner of Volvo. After nearly two decades of cooperation, Volvo has earned its revenue and become the high-performance department of the group.

However, there is still much prospect for competition in the traditional fuel vehicle sector, which has become a problem that Volvo has to think about. Especially in the past few years when Tesla was leading the way, there were a bunch of new car companies trying to enter the field of high-performance electric vehicles, and transformation became an inevitable choice.

In fact, Polestar wants to build electric cars not to adapt to Volvo's strategic needs. At the beginning of the acquisition, it hopes to build a "sexy" electric car, but it has not been put into practice. In the five years after the acquisition, Polestar also performed very well, contributing 15% of sales to Volvo.

According to Volvo's plan, Polestar's future models will share resources with Volvo, but will not hang Volvo's logo. For Volvo, this may be more secure, but for the new brand Polestar, there will be a brand awareness. problem.

Is it really a bit of a violation between a brand that is known for its safety and a high-performance electric vehicle? I am afraid this is one of the reasons why Volvo wants to distinguish the two.

Brand new team

After confirming the independence of Polestar, Volvo also announced a new team of this new brand. Thomas Ingenlath, senior vice president of global design for Volvo Cars, became the new CEO of the Polestar brand.

The 53-year-old Ingrat achieved good results in the design of Volvo, and contributed to Volvo's sales growth. His leading design XC90 won many awards, which also helped him enter the Volvo core management team.

Jonathan Goodman, senior vice president of Volvo PR, will be the new COO for Polestar. Goodman is also 53 years old this year. Before coming to Volvo, he was in charge of public relations at the PSA Group.

Let a designer be the CEO of a brand new brand, how much can see Volvo's positioning of Polestar, they really want to create a sexy, emotional high-performance electric car, in addition to technology, this new brand may want more humanity Personalized side.

The independence of the Polestar brand and the entry of Volvo into the field of high-performance electric vehicles seem to have made us see the distinctive side of this Nordic brand. In fact, this aspect has always existed.

In 1959, Volvo established a special racing department, and it also won awards in all kinds of competitions, but its safe and reliable brand impression is deeply rooted, which has diluted the other side of its pursuit of speed and passion.

But starting with Polestar, Volvo will also start to show muscle.
